Michel A. Arcand is a scholar working on Surgery,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Michel A. Arcand has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 318 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Surgery, 6 papers in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ism and 3 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Michel A. Arcand's work include Shoulder Injury and Treatment (7 papers), Hormonal and reproductive studies (6 papers) and Knee injuries and reconstruction techniques (3 papers). Michel A. Arcand is often cited by papers focused on Shoulder Injury and Treatment (7 papers), Hormonal and reproductive studies (6 papers) and Knee injuries and reconstruction techniques (3 papers). Michel A. Arcand collaborates with scholars based in United States, Taiwan and Russia. Michel A. Arcand's co-authors include C. Christopher Stroud, Melanie D. Palm, Kenneth Mroczek, Bruce Reider, Wayne Z. Burkhead, John G. Skedros, Souad Rhalmi, Charles‐Hilaire Rivard, James A. Albright and Edward J. Testa and has published in prestigious journals such as Clinical Orthopaedics and Related Research, Arthroscopy The Journal of Arthroscopic and Related Surgery and Journal of Shoulder and Elbow Surgery.
